Cask at Picture House, Stafford. Pours a slightly hazy golden yellow with a medium sized frothy almost white head and good lacing. Is slow to clear but does eventually. The aroma has vanilla, malts and biscuits. In the mouth it is sweet with a decidedly creamy texture. Flavour has vanilla, malts and a hint of toffee. Later on traces of apricot and chewy fruit sweets come through as well. Finish is dry with a slight stickiness. This is quite nice – and definitely unusual ! I’ve drank white stouts before but this is the first one that really justifies the title.
